So I am highly interested in purchasing an InCase brand neoprene sleeve for my Dell laptop. Incase designs specifically for the Apple lineup. Looks like my laptop falls just inbetween their two designs as far as dimensions go for their lineup of sleeves.

So which would you recommend, the 13" or 15" sleeve?

Dell Inspiron 1420 (My Machine)

Weight: Starting at 5.39 lbs (2.45kg)9
Width: 13.13" (33.3cm)
Height: 1.26" (3.2cm) front - 1.53" (3.9cm) back
Depth: 9.61" (24.4cm)


Option #1 Incase 13" Neoprene Sleeve
http://goincase.com/products/detail/13-neoprene-sleeve-cl57089

Interior: 12.78 x 8.92 x 1.08 inches
Designed for Macbooks (same dimensions)



Option #2 Incase 15" Neoprene Sleeve
http://goincase.com/products/detail/15-neoprene-sleeve-cl57090

Interior: 14.1 x 9.6 x 1 inches
Designed for Macbook Pro (same dimensions)
